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Shotts to Epsom Downs start from as little as £51.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Shotts to Epsom Downs start from £125.60 one way, or £179.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Shotts to Epsom Downs are available for £202.10 one way, or £404.20 return

Facilities and Amenities at Shotts Station

At Shotts, you'll find a well-equipped station catering to most traveler needs. While waiting for your train, enjoy the convenience of ticket offices open weekdays and Saturdays from 06:30 to 13:20, supported by accessible ticket machines that facilitate easy collection of tickets bought online. Step into the waiting room, integrated with the ticket office, to find some solace until your departure. There’s also sufficient seating available for all travelers to use.

Your security and support are covered with CCTV surveillance throughout the station and helpful staff assistance available during office hours. Travel with ease using the step-free access and ramps available to both platforms, marking this as a Category B station, ideal for passengers requiring additional mobility support.

Transport Links and Accessibility

The connectivity continues beyond the platform. Utilize the bus services linked from the station via the SPT Park & Ride on Foundry Road. You can find more information on bus services at www.travelinescotland.com, ensuring a smooth onward journey. Taxis are just a call away, and details can be acquired from www.traintaxi.co.uk for a quick ride to your nearby destination.

If you're heading to Shotts with your bicycle, fear not, as the station provides secured and sheltered bicycle stands. The ample parking space with CCTV ensures both your vehicle and two-wheeler are kept safe. Although the station's amenities do not currently include refreshment facilities or public Wi-Fi, the reassurance of free parking is a welcoming feature.

Station Facilities and Travel Assistance

Epsom Downs station, though lacking a ticket office, is equipped with ticket machines where you can collect your tickets, especially if you've booked online. These machines are designed to be accessible, offering facilities for those with a Disabled Persons Railcard. While the station does not boast an indoor waiting room or seating areas, it provides step-free access across all platforms, categorized as a Category A station. This ensures ease of mobility for everyone, particularly those with accessibility needs.

For customer assistance, the station is equipped with help points, and if you require further help, assistance can be pre-arranged. Although there are no dedicated staff rooms, assistance is generally available via mobile teams. Keep in mind, Epsom Downs doesn’t offer amenities like toilets or refreshments, so it’s advised to plan accordingly.
